WereldLichtjesDag: rouwen in de klas
Elke 2e zondag in december wordt WereldLichtjesDag, dag van het overleden kind, gehouden. Misschien heeft iemand in je klas iemand dierbaar verloren. Wie weet helpt deze speciale dag om rouwen een plaats te geven op school.
Overleden kinderen herdenken
Op deze dag steken mensen om 19.00 uur over de hele wereld kaarsjes aan ter nagedachtenis aan overleden kinderen. Het maakt daarbij niet uit hoe oud het kind was of hoe lang het al geleden is. De wereld wordt zo even letterlijk wat lichter voor mensen die een kind verloren hebben en daarnaast is er het besef dat je niet alleen bent met je verdriet.
